Delay in opening of Pottermore e-book store

Posted on October 2, 2011 by CarolineC in News, Other

Tweet

According to TheBookseller.com the opening of the Pottermore e-book shop for the Harry Potter series has been pushed back to the first half of 2012. It was due to open in October 2011.
